What is e-Wallet?
A digital wallet refers to an electronic device that allows an individual to make electronic commerce transactions.
Used with- smart phone and computer.

Findings 68.8% of respondents use E-wallet - easy to make payment and time
saving too. Paytm- highest users Among nonusers- 96.9% are willing –situation permits 51% of respondents were Moderately satisfied
